Combined Effect of Seasonality and Hyponatremia on the Occurrence of Hip Fractures Among Older Adults.

There is a combined effect of seasonality and hyponatremia on the occurrence of hip fractures among older adults, with hyponatremic patients being at a higher risk of sustaining a hip fracture during winter season than during other seasons. In addition, the association between hyponatremia on admission and mortality rate at latest follow-up among hip fracture patients has been confirmed.
